Mount Sion galloped into a place in the semi-finals of the Senior Hurling Championship with a facile victory over 14-man Ballyduff Lower at Kill last Saturday afternoon. This game was played in the sweltering autumn sun but it was Mount Sion who were in red-hot form as they demolished a disappointing Ballyduff side. In truth, the result of this game was never really in doubt from the moment that Jason Phelan poked home Mount Sion’s second goal in the ninth minute.

Both teams racked up early scores as Paul Kennedy’s excellent early score from the left touchline was cancelled out by a long-range free by Ken McGrath.

In the fifth minute, we had the first major talking point of the game. Mount Sion’s centre-forward, Ross O’Keeffe gathered a loose ball 25 yards from goal. He shot and turned in the one movement and poor Ballyduff goalkeeper, Brian O’Leary never even saw it as it flew into his top right corner.
